Sandworm Leverages Fake Job Interviews to Distribute Trojanized WireGuard VPN
The notorious Sandworm advanced persistent threat (APT) group has devised a sophisticated new attack vector, transforming the conventional job interview process into a conduit for compromising IT professionals. This multi-stage campaign employs elaborate social engineering tactics, including mock recruiter conversations, live video calls, and a booby-trapped virtual private network (VPN) client, to gain access to individuals who often hold elevated privileges within corporate networks.

Targeting IT Specialists Through Deceptive Recruitment
The operation specifically targets system administrators and other IT specialists, with attackers meticulously reviewing resumes found on popular job-search platforms. The initial engagement typically begins with an unsolicited message from a purported employer, transitioning into chat-based interactions, and culminating in a technical assessment that seemingly necessitates a connection to a corporate VPN.
CERT-UA said in a report that their analysts have attributed this activity to UAC-0145, a subgroup associated with Sandworm, also known as APT44 or Seashell Blizzard. The agency indicated that this campaign has been operational since at least May 2026, highlighting the effectiveness of staged recruitment fraud in circumventing typical technical suspicions. This campaign is particularly concerning due to its focus on individuals responsible for network maintenance and remote access, where the pressure of a credible interview can lead to hasty software installations.
The Sophisticated Sandworm Fake Job Interview Lure
The attackers initiate contact by impersonating legitimate IT employers. Early communications are facilitated through job-site chat platforms and Telegram. These exchanges are followed by a seemingly standard English-language screening and a Zoom video conference, which appears to involve a real human recruiter. This patient and convincing approach mirrors other fake job interview threats, where familiar hiring steps lull candidates into a false sense of security.
Subsequently, candidates receive technical interview instructions via email, which include WireGuard configuration files for either Linux or Windows. These files are presented as essential for completing a test task on the “corporate network.” When the initial connection invariably fails, the interviewer then suggests downloading a custom VPN client, named “SopraVPN,” from a project page linked on the fake company’s website.
This redirection is the core of the attack. The “SopraVPN” application is a modified version based on the legitimate WireGuard source code. As previous incidents involving poisoned VPN apps have demonstrated, a functional client does not guarantee its safety.
CERT-UA’s analysis revealed that the modified client incorporates an additional configuration setting, “SymmetricKey.” This setting, combined with the configuration’s private key, is used to decrypt embedded PowerShell code. On Windows systems, this code then establishes a scheduled task and proceeds to download further payloads from the internet. For Linux targets, the variant utilizes curl to retrieve another executable from attacker-controlled infrastructure, leveraging the VPN’s configuration for the DNS server address. The altered software also introduces changes to the standard Base64 key decoding process.


What You Should Do
- Verify All Job Offers: Independently verify the legitimacy of any recruiting contact through official company channels (e.g., corporate website, LinkedIn) before engaging in interviews or installing any software. Do not rely on contact information provided by the recruiter.
- Scrutinize Software Requests: Treat any request to download or install custom VPN clients, altered configurations, or software from external, unverified sources as a critical red flag, especially if it follows a “technical issue” during an interview.
- Isolate Technical Tasks: For IT professionals, conduct any technical assessment tasks requiring code execution or network access within isolated, disposable virtual environments, never on your primary workstation or devices connected to your organization’s network.
- Implement Strict Device Policies: Organizations, particularly telecommunications providers and IT companies, should enforce policies that only permit access to corporate resources from managed devices equipped with endpoint protection, defined security policies, and continuous monitoring. This applies even to personally owned devices used for work.
- Educate Employees: Regularly alert staff about sophisticated social engineering tactics, including recruiter impersonation and malicious job platform schemes. Emphasize that legitimate recruitment processes do not bypass established software acquisition protocols or device controls.
- Establish Reporting Procedures: Create a clear and accessible process for employees to report suspicious recruitment contacts to the security team immediately. This allows for prompt investigation, evidence preservation, and timely warnings to other potential targets.
- Monitor for Anomalies: Security teams should actively monitor for unusual scheduled tasks, PowerShell activity, and new or unauthorized VPN configurations on endpoints.
